Available in 11 Languages

Both the web app and the mobile app are now available in 11 languages–English, Arabic, Burmese, Chinese, French, Haitian Creole, Hakha Chin, Karen, Spanish, Swahili, and Yoruba. You can easily switch between languages by selecting the langage dropdown menu on the top right side of the screen.

Home Screen Navigation

Our home screen looks and functions differently now. You can now use the search bar to find resources by name or location, or you can select a category to see all resources in that category. As you scroll down, you’ll be able to preview some of the resources available nearby.

Share a Resource

Found a great resource and want to share it with a friend? You can now easily share details about a food pantry, meal site, SNAP or WIC store, WIC clinic, or event. Just press the “share” button and select the app you’d like to use to share the resource.

Updated Wording

Some of the words used throughout the app have changed in order to make it easier to understand. For example, “retailers” has been changed to “stores,” and “eligibility” has been changed to “who can get food.” If you’re still confused by any of the words used on the app, check out the glossary on our Help page.

New Filters for Free Groceries & Free Meals

Sometimes there are so many available food resources that the map can be overwhelming. That’s where filters come in. You can now filter map results to see food resources based on:

      • day open
      • times open
      • documents required
      • age requirements
      • location

Sort & Filter Events

With the new app, it’s easier to find free food-related events near you. Using the Events & Classes section, you can now sort results by date and location, and you can filter results by event type, including: Summer Meals for Kids, Food Giveaways, Health Fairs, Cooking and Nutrition Classes, Farmers Markets, WIC Events, and Other.

Collaborative Data Management

With the new backend of the app, trusted partners throughout the state can now suggest edits to the resources listed on Community Compass, making it easier to keep every food pantry, meal site, and other resource updated. F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S (FAQ)

Who is this new version available to? When is it going public to everyone?
On March 30, 2023, this redesigned experience will launch for all users. Community Compass is still available for free to everyone, and includes resources throughout Indiana.
